DAYTONA DUEL 2 (Budweiser Shoot Out)
Segment 2
Second half of this race with 50 laps to complete Carl Edwards Starting at pole position,green flag and the race was off!! Casey Cain giving Edwards a pretty good shove at the start helping Edwards keep the lead. With Mcmurry hungry for the lead side by side with Carl Edwards with 45 laps to go Edwards was really fighting to hold on to the lead.Caution comes out, with 43 laps to go #2 Kurt Busch hits the wall what a "wild ride", Kurt experianced!! 39 laps to complete green light and the race was off again.Carl Edwards and Tony Stewart side by side what a battle had this became.Another caution comes out due to a tire going down and dabree on the track from Jeff Burtons car.Green flag once again Carl and Stewart neck and neck with 32 laps to go,Tony Stewart finally passes Edwards and Harvick trailing behind wanting a peice of the pie!!Then Harvick takes the lead with Tony Stewart and Biffle trailing behind as Carl Edwards falls behind.Edwards regains positions and battles biffle for the lead Carl just not giving up.As Biffle holds the lead as all cars go 4 wide and the all the sudden out of no where Harvick and Stewart pass Biffle for for another fight for the lead!!!With 15 laps to go Harvick falls back now with Vickers beside Stewart with 11 laps to go Harvick passes by with a push and takes the the lead,but here came Mcmurry out of no where passing Harvick.Now it was back and forth as finally Harvick regains the lead to hold on to it,then another caution appears Newman runs into Micheal Waldrip 4th caution of the night.Biffle stays out as everyone else goes to pit row.With 2 laps to go it looked to be a green white checker flag finish Biffle and Casey Cain sharing the restart Harvick drops to the bottom of the track passes Biffle and Cain with a huge reck in the back feild Harvick wins the Budweiser Shootout!!!
